Consistency Over Timing: A Personal Approach
While timing can influence specific benefits, many health experts emphasize that consistency is more important than a perfect schedule. The most important thing is to find a routine that can be maintained daily. Consistent use is far better than inconsistent usage.
For those with sensitive stomachs, taking the oil with food can help mitigate any potential irritation or belching. Mixing it with honey, juice, or adding it to a smoothie can also help mask its strong, peppery flavor.
Dosage and Considerations
Standard dosage recommendations typically range from one to three teaspoons per day, but it's important to start with a smaller amount (e.g., half a teaspoon) to see how the body reacts. For those taking it in capsules, follow the product's recommended dosage. Always consult a healthcare provider before adding any new supplement to your routine, especially if you have existing conditions or take other medications.
